How to Develop New Traits in Your Personality
Leveraging personal growth and enhancing your personality can significantly impact both your professional and personal life. Developing new character traits involves a blend of self-awareness, intentional practice, and exposure to new experiences. This comprehensive guide will walk you through the steps to add new traits to your personality effectively.
Identify Desired Traits
The first step in developing a new trait is to clearly define what you want to achieve. Reflect on the traits you believe would benefit you and align with your values or goals. For instance, if you feel that being more outgoing would help you in your social interactions, clearly identify this as one of your desired traits.
Set Specific Goals
Once you have identified the traits, break them down into specific, achievable goals. For example, if you aim to be more outgoing, set a goal to initiate a conversation with a new person each week. This approach will help you stay on track and monitor your progress effectively.
Practice Mindfulness
Becoming more aware of your thoughts and behaviors is crucial. Mindfulness practices such as meditation can significantly increase self-awareness. By understanding your thought patterns and behaviors, you can identify instances where you may be acting in ways that do not align with your desired traits. This self-awareness is the foundation for behavioral change.

Engage in New Experiences
Stepping out of your comfort zone is essential. Trying new activities, meeting new people, or volunteering can help you cultivate traits like openness, empathy, or confidence. These experiences can expose you to different perspectives and help you grow.
Model Behavior
Observing and learning from people who embody the traits you want to develop can provide practical examples. This can inspire you to incorporate those traits into your own life. Pay attention to how others display these traits and strive to emulate them in your own behavior.
Be Patient and Persistent
Changing your personality traits is a gradual process. Celebrate small victories along the way and be patient with yourself. Progress may feel slow at times, but consistency and persistence are key to long-term success.
Reflect and Adjust
Regularly assess your progress and reflect on what is working and what isn't. Be willing to adjust your approach as needed. Continuous evaluation ensures that you stay on track and make necessary changes to achieve your goals.
